PCIe Motherboard Compatibility

Slot Standard: PCIe 5.0 x16 — But Backward Compatible

The RTX 5060 Ti uses a PCIe 5.0 x16 interface. However, PCIe is fully backward and forward compatible across generations. This means:

  • PCIe 5.0 motherboards (Intel 700-series, AMD 800-series chipsets): Full bandwidth, no bottleneck.
  • PCIe 4.0 motherboards (Intel 500/600-series, AMD 500-series chipsets): The card will work at PCIe 4.0 speeds. For a card at this performance tier, PCIe 4.0 x16 provides more than enough bandwidth — multiple independent benchmarks from prior GPU generations have shown negligible performance differences between PCIe 4.0 and 5.0 for mid-range GPUs.
  • PCIe 3.0 motherboards (Intel 300/400-series, AMD 300/400-series chipsets): The card will still function. There may be a small performance penalty in bandwidth-intensive scenarios (typically 1–3% according to hardware review outlets that tested RTX 40-series cards on PCIe 3.0), but for most gaming workloads the impact is minimal.

Physical Slot Requirements

The card requires a standard full-length x16 PCIe slot. Virtually every ATX, Micro-ATX, and Mini-ITX motherboard manufactured in the last decade includes at least one x16 slot. The key consideration for smaller form factors is whether the slot has adequate clearance from other components — more on that in the case section below.

CPU Compatibility Note

The GPU itself is CPU-agnostic — it will work with any processor that has a PCIe x16 slot available through the motherboard. However, to avoid CPU bottlenecking at the RTX 5060 Ti’s performance level, hardware reviewers generally recommend at least a modern mid-range processor (e.g., Intel Core i5-12400 or newer, AMD Ryzen 5 5600 or newer).

Power Supply Compatibility

TDP and Recommended Wattage

NVIDIA’s official recommendation for RTX 5060 Ti systems is a 550W power supply, based on the card’s TDP (total board power) which falls in the range typical of this tier. This is notably lower than the RTX 4070 Ti’s 600W recommendation, reflecting Blackwell’s improved power efficiency.

However, the 550W figure assumes a balanced system. If you’re running a high-end CPU (e.g., Intel Core i9 or AMD Ryzen 9), multiple storage drives, or extensive RGB/fan setups, a 650W PSU provides a more comfortable margin.

Power Connector: 16-Pin (12V-2×6)

The PNY RTX 5060 Ti OC uses a single 16-pin 12V-2×6 power connector (also sometimes referred to as 12VHPWR in earlier documentation, though the updated 12V-2×6 spec includes improved mechanical reliability). Here’s what that means for your PSU:

  • ATX 3.0 / ATX 3.1 PSUs: These natively include a 16-pin cable. Plug and play — this is the ideal scenario.
  • Older ATX 2.x PSUs: You’ll need to use a dual 8-pin to 16-pin adapter cable. Most RTX 5060 Ti cards ship with this adapter in the box (PNY’s documentation confirms adapter inclusion). When using an adapter, ensure the two 8-pin cables come from separate PSU rails or cables — daisy-chaining a single cable into both 8-pin ends can cause voltage issues under load.

PSU Efficiency Rating

While any PSU meeting the wattage requirement will technically work, an 80 Plus Bronze or higher rated unit is recommended for stable voltage delivery. Reviewers consistently note that cheap, unrated PSUs can cause instability with modern GPUs due to voltage ripple.

Case and Physical Fit Compatibility

The SFF-Ready Advantage

One of the RTX 5060 Ti’s most significant compatibility features is its SFF-Ready designation. This is an NVIDIA-defined standard indicating the card meets specific dimensional constraints for small form factor builds. The PNY Dual Fan variant is a dual-slot card, which is notably slimmer than the 2.5- or 3-slot designs common in higher-tier GPUs.

Dimensional Considerations

Based on PNY’s product specifications and the SFF-Ready standard:

  • Length: SFF-Ready cards must be under approximately 304 mm (12 inches). The dual-fan design on this PNY model keeps it well within standard mid-tower clearance ranges. Most mid-tower cases support GPUs up to 330–380 mm.
  • Height: Standard dual-slot height, compatible with any case that accepts a standard PCIe expansion card.
  • Thickness: Dual-slot (approximately 40 mm), meaning it occupies exactly two expansion slot brackets.

Monitor and Display Compatibility

Display Outputs

The RTX 5060 Ti supports modern display standards. Based on NVIDIA’s Blackwell specifications and PNY’s product documentation, expect:

  • DisplayPort 2.1a: Supports resolutions up to 8K and high refresh rates at 4K (4K at 240Hz with DSC).
  • HDMI 2.1: Supports 4K at 120Hz, compatible with modern TVs and monitors.

The PNY Dual Fan model typically includes three DisplayPort and one HDMI output, supporting up to four simultaneous displays.

Resolution and Refresh Rate Compatibility

  • 1080p monitors: Fully compatible. The RTX 5060 Ti is overkill for 1080p 60Hz but excellent for 1080p at 144Hz, 240Hz, or even 360Hz gaming.
  • 1440p monitors: The sweet spot for this card. Expect strong performance at 1440p with high refresh rates.
  • 4K monitors: Compatible and capable, though frame rates will depend on game settings. DLSS 4 (Multi Frame Generation) can significantly boost effective frame rates.
  • Ultrawide monitors (3440×1440, 5120×1440): Fully supported via DisplayPort.

Adaptive Sync

The card supports NVIDIA G-Sync and is compatible with G-Sync Compatible (FreeSync) monitors. Any monitor with adaptive sync over DisplayPort should work without issue.

Common Compatibility Questions Answered

Will the RTX 5060 Ti work with my older motherboard?

Almost certainly yes. Any motherboard with a PCIe x16 slot (Gen 3.0 or newer) will physically and electrically support the card. You may lose a small amount of bandwidth on PCIe 3.0, but gaming performance impact is minimal.

Do I need to upgrade my power supply?

If your current PSU is 550W or higher and has either a native 16-pin connector or two separate 8-pin PCIe power cables (for use with the included adapter), you’re set. If your PSU is under 550W or only has a single 8-pin PCIe cable, an upgrade is recommended.

Will it fit in my Mini-ITX case?

The SFF-Ready designation means it’s specifically designed for small builds. Check your case manufacturer’s maximum GPU length specification — if it supports cards around 300 mm or longer, the PNY Dual Fan model should fit. Always verify against your specific case’s published specs.

Can I use it with a FreeSync monitor?

Yes. NVIDIA’s G-Sync Compatible program supports most FreeSync monitors over DisplayPort. HDMI VRR is also supported on HDMI 2.1 monitors.

Is it compatible with DLSS 4?

Yes. As a Blackwell architecture GPU, the RTX 5060 Ti supports DLSS 4, including Multi Frame Generation, which can dramatically increase frame rates in supported titles.
